Job Description:

The Site Reliability Engineering practice combines software and systems engineering to build tools to run and manage enterprise solutions. Their responsibility is to bridge the gap between development and operations, aiming to expedite development work while retaining high level of system resiliency. With a focus on operational excellence, the SR Engineer builds and monitors dashboards to provide proactive alerting mechanisms to themselves and the respective agile teams. They drive operational excellence by working alongside agile teams to provide reliable automated deployment processes across all environments.

The SR Engineers work closely with developer and support roles to ensure the production environment provides the proper end user experience. This is achieved by optimizing on-call rotations and processes to ensure proper operational support is provided to our customers.

Responsibilities

  • Set strategy and develop a roadmap for the team aimed towards reducing the operational overhead of keeping Extend applications healthy, secure, and available for our customers.
  • Collaborate across domains to drive ownership of production systems, enable faster decision making and transparent observability into system health.
  • Drive service reliability by developing methodology around metric visibility using SLIs, SLOs, and SLAs.
  • Evangelize SRE best practices across the organization and promote better monitoring practices and a proactive approach to reliability and observability.
  • Advocate for and drive the implementation of reliable design patterns.
  • Build and implement incident management - alerting, triage, run books, post mortem and RCA.
  • Promote simplicity in solving complex problems across our technology footprint.
  • Lead and focus teams on root cause analysis, pattern identification and continuous improvement in order to optimize application performance, resiliency and reliability.
  • Organizing, Securing, and automating infrastructure deployments.
  • Brainstorming and championing operational improvements.
  • Documenting tribal Knowledge.
  • Communicate and work alongside members across multiple teams in support of their day-to-day work items.
  • Gather and analyze metrics from our solutions to assist in performance tuning.
  • Continued education to learn additional technologies, programming languages, industry best practices and tools that are needed.
  • Serve as an escalation point and mentor for all agile team members on technical issues.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

SRE needs to be well-rounded in tech skills. Along with coding and automation acumen, SREs should have strong knowledge of operating systems, networks, virtualization, and CI/CD pipeline tools. There's no substitute for this level of expertise.

  • Data structures and algorithms. A solid grasp of data structures, algorithms, and RESTful APIs.
  • Kubernetes experience. An understanding of working in Kubernetes systems with experience with docker containers.
  • Drive for automation. You constantly consider, "How can I automate this manual process?"
  • Extensive experience with cloud-based technologies and solutions (we are heavily invested in Google's Cloud Platform).
  • Expert knowledge of scripting language.
  • Expert knowledge of SQL.
  • Experience with, and knowledge of, Terraform, Ansible, Github.
  • Knowledge of DevOps tools and mindset.
  • Ability to work alongside others and be a team player.
  • Desire to learn and adapt. Our agile team has a lot of projects going on at once, and you'll have the opportunity to learn to navigate the code and features. You'll constantly be learning new areas and new technologies.
  • Passion. Our customers are passionate about real estate data, and we want the same from our engineers. We want you to actively own your work and be excited about your projects.
  • Operational excellence. Data excites you and you make decisions based on numbers rather than assumptions. If an issue arises, you strive to be alerted before our customers notice.
  • Keeping calm and carrying on. Capable in navigating through a service outage, skilled in identifying performance bottlenecks, and figuring out the root cause of incidents.
